Summary

The Workers Compensation Programs Office (WCPO) has released a draft CM-972 form for public comment. The draft form relates to federal workers' compensation claims procedures under programs such as FECA. Employers, employees, and claims administrators should review the proposed form and submit comments during the designated comment period.

What changed

The WCPO has published a draft CM-972 form for workers' compensation claims. This appears to be a new or revised form used in the administration of federal workers' compensation programs. The draft is open for public comment, allowing stakeholders to provide feedback on the form's content, instructions, or data collection elements.

Affected parties including federal employees, employers, insurance carriers, and claims administrators should review the draft form carefully. Those with operational experience using workers' compensation forms may wish to submit comments regarding clarity of instructions, required data fields, or potential administrative burden before the form is finalized.
